CLIMATE COMMISSION WELCOMES PRESIDENT’S CALL FOR NOMINATIONS OF NEW COMMISSIONERS

The Presidential Climate Commission (PCC) welcomes President Cyril Ramaphosa’s invitation and call for South Africans to nominate commissioners to serve on the second term of commission. Established in 2020 with the President as the Chairperson, the current term ends on 31 December 2025, and the new Commission will serve for a period of five years in terms of the Climate Change Act, 2024 (Act No. 22 of 2024)

The call was officially gazetted on 07 August 2025 in accordance with sections 10(4)(a) and 12(1)(a) of the Climate Change Act, 2024 (Act No. 22 of 2024) empowering the President to appoint the members of the Commission through a public nomination process. In terms of the Act, appointed commissioners, must be fit and proper persons, with diverse knowledge expertise in the socio-economic, environmental, community development and should be diversely representative of various stakeholders.

The Commission believes that the transparent and democratic nomination process will empower the President to select a body of diverse opinions, views, and ideas necessary for the PCC to continue to fulfil its mandate of advising on South Africa’s response to climate change and a just transition towards low-emissions and climate-resilient economy.

The PCC implore stakeholders, institutions, and members of the public to actively to take part in the nomination process by submitting nominations for new Commissioners, the closing date for submissions is 29 August 2025, no later than 16: 00.

“The PCCs independence, integrity and validity depends on the continued engagement of diverse sectors of society in shaping climate and development policy. We remain committed to a just and equitable society working together with all partners to drive social inclusion and a just transition that leaves no one behind” said Dr Crispian Olver, Deputy Chairperson of the Commission
